Factors Affecting Cost
- Crack Size and Severity: Larger and deeper cracks generally require more materials and labor, increasing the overall cost.
- Repair Method: Different methods, such as epoxy injections or polyurethane foam, come with varying price tags.
- Labor Costs: Labor rates can vary based on the contractor's experience and the complexity of the job.
- Material Quality: Higher quality materials might cost more but offer better long-term results.
- Accessibility: Hard-to-reach areas may require additional tools and time, impacting the price.
- Additional Damage: If the crack is part of a larger structural issue, additional repairs may be needed, raising the cost.
Common Tasks and Costs
Task Description | Average Cost (Greenville, NC) |
---|---|
Minor Crack Repair | $100 - $300 |
Epoxy Injection | $250 - $750 |
Polyurethane Foam Injection | $200 - $600 |
Structural Crack Repair | $500 - $1,500 |
Foundation Inspection | $150 - $400 |
Waterproofing | $500 - $1,200 |
